KEY CONTRIBUTIONS
Focused on product development, materials, and costing, with hands-on experience in RLM systems and vendor coordination.
Materials & Fabric Development
• Participated in fabric meetings and supported seasonal material selection
• Communicated with vendors to adjust materials (weight, pattern, pricing)
• Managed fabric data, updated pricing, and organized material binders
• Identified missing TDS and supported price calculations
Fittings & Technical Support
• Attended fittings and supported silhouette and material adjustments
• Assisted garment measurement and documented fit changes
• Collaborated with design and technical teams to refine fit and construction
PLM (RLM), Data & Costing
• Managed BOMs and style data in RLM, including RMID, suppliers, and colorways
• Updated material attributes, lead times, MOQ, and content in the system
• Maintained color descriptions based on HTS data and tracked materials in Excel
• Updated factory allocation charts to support production planning
• Developed invoices and compared with costing charts to ensure accuracy
• Analyzed FOB and CMA cost structures for final reimbursement calculations
